Molly Adler, LMSW, ACS
Molly Adler is a Licensed Master Social Worker and Board Certified Sexologist with the American College of Sexologists. Molly is a therapist at Healthy Families of Albuquerque. She enjoys working with individuals and couples on sexuality and gender issues, intimacy, relationships and life transitions. Molly believes in a holistic approach to wellness through personal empowerment. Her approach is collaborative and interactive, encompassing mindfulness-based cognitive behavioral therapy, attachment theory, narrative therapy, person-centered therapy, and psychoeducation. She is honored to collaborate on another’s journey of self-discovery.
In 2007, Molly co-founded Self Serve Sexuality Resource Center, New Mexico’s first women-run, education-based, award-winning, sex-positive shop. Currently, Molly is the Co-Chair of the LGBT Task Force of the National Association of Social Workers New Mexico (NASW-NM). She offers trainings on LGBTQ* issues, sexuality and cultural humility in mental health. Molly has presented at Harvard, Tufts, University of New Mexico, the New Mexico Conference on Aging, and the NASW-NM Conference.
